What is Medigap?
Because Medicare simply can not be relied on to cover all of your healthcare
expenses, privately owned insurance companies offer health plans known as 'Medigap'
or Medicare Supplemental policies to fill in the various coverage gaps that
Federal Medicare has left behind.
On the whole, Medigap polices provide coverage for most, though not all, of
Medicare's coinsurance fees and deductibles. Medicare Supplement plans may
also offer you benefits for healthcare services that aren't typically covered
by Medicare. |
